Title: The Innovations of Ernst Lindtner

Introduction

Ernst Lindtner is a notable inventor based in Baden, Austria. He has made significant contributions to the field of engineering, particularly in the automotive sector. With a total of four patents to his name, Lindtner's work focuses on enhancing vehicle safety and performance through innovative designs.

Latest Patents

One of Lindtner's latest patents is for a bumper assembly. This invention involves a method of making a beam-box crash management system. It comprises forming a first shell from a sheet metal blank using a hot forming process. The first shell features a high tensile strength beam portion and integrally formed low yield strength crash box portions at both ends. Additionally, the design includes an open face extending continuously along the beam portion and crash box portions. Another significant patent is for a front axle mounting with crash grooves. This subframe is designed as a cross member for vehicles and includes two side members with a stiffening structure. The side members are hollow profile pieces with predetermined buckling points to improve mechanical properties while ensuring cost-effective production.

Career Highlights

Throughout his career, Lindtner has worked with prominent companies in the automotive industry. He has been associated with Cosma Engineering Europe AG and Magna International Inc., where he has contributed to various engineering projects.
